Tracklisting / Additional Info: David Bowie - The Man Who Sold The World
Mercury 6338041 - 1971
UK white label LP test pressing with correct machine-stamped matrix numbers:
Side one 6338041 1Y // 1V420
Side two 6338041 2Y // 1V420
Original withdrawn 'Dress / Drag' picture sleeve.

This has to the one of the ultimate Bowie record collectables. Not only is this album a great rarity as a finished commercial copy, this is a white label test pressing - there would not have been more than a handful of these produced and none would have gone beyond the immediate circle of artist & label executives involved in the release of this album.

As shown above, the vinyl carries the correct machine-stamped matrix numbers for the Mercury pressing - this would have been one of the first records manufactured before the commercial production run was ordered.

The plain white labels show spider traces around the spindle hole indicating perhaps 4 or 5 plays for side one, and just 2 or 3 plays for side 2. The words 'David Bowie Side 1' and 'David Bowie Side 2' have been handwritten in red on each side. The record both looks and plays as a Mint condition record - one of the best you will ever see.

The 'dress' sleeve is one of the most talked about of rare records, and regularly appears in want lists and editorial alike. This copy remains in Excellent condition. Given its source the provenance is impeccable, but just for the record it is undoubtedly 100% original and genuine. It is constructed from the familiar textured paper stock (it almost feels like expensive wallpaper); the spine titles read top to bottom and the clock is visible on the mantelpiece.

There are no seam splits, the corners remain strong and the internal flipback construction is totally secure. There is a noticeable thin-line defect running across the top of the front cover, and a similiar albeit feinter line running across the bottom. At some stage the sleeve has been stapled and there is a twin-prong staple hole in each of the four corners. This sleeve has not suffered the usual ringwear problems that have afflicted so many other copies - thankfully the record was stored outside the sleeve for most of its 34+ years. In fact it woud appear that for some time the sleeve was stapled to a wall, or on display somewhere, resulting in the very minimal ringwear but you do get the staple holes - both a blessing and a curse, or a 'choose your poison' event!
